Don’t take suicide attempts for granted – Experts advise Nigerians

Mental health experts have advised Nigerians not to take suicide attempts for granted. They made this declaration while speaking at the weekend during a webinar on the topic, ‘Suicide prevention: warning sings, risk factors and intervention strategies’. Four teenage girls drown in Jigawa river

Four teenage girl have reportedly drowned in a river at Malkaderi village, in Gagarawa Local Government Area of Jigawa State tate. A resident told DAILY POST that the incident occurred on Saturday evening when the girls, who are from the same family, went to swim in the pond. He said all the victims drowned in the pond and their remains were evacuated by good Samaritans. Spokesman of the Jigawa State Police command DSP. EPL: I’m happy at Crystal Palace -Eze

Crystal Palace winger, Eberechi Eze says he is happy at the London club. The England international has been consistently linked with a move away from Selhurst Park. Eze however remained at the club despite another top talent, Michael Olise, leaving for Bundesliga giants, Bayern Munich. The 26-year-old said he won’t force a move away from the Eagles. “I really want to enjoy my football where I am right now. Kano recommits to polio eradication, targets 3.6 million kids

The Kano State Governor, Abba Yusuf, on Sunday restated the state government’s commitment to end polio and other childhood communicable diseases, as it collaborates with partners to target 3.6 million children in the state. He made the pledge in Kano at the weekend while unveiling the 2024 polio eradication campaign in Dawakin Kudu local government of the state. Apple may release an iPad-like smart home display next year

Apple is preparing to take a fresh run at the smart home that starts with a rumored smart display that it may release next year.
